RIYADH – The foreign ministers of Egypt, Qatar, Jordan and the UAE arrived in the Saudi capital, Riyadh, to participate in the ministerial meeting on Gaza.
Upon their arrival at King Khalid International Airport, they were received by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s, Eng. Walid bin Abdul Karim Al-Khereiji.

The Times of Israel newspaper said that Saudi Arabia is preparing to host a summit that will lead to a unified Arab position on the war in Gaza, in addition to initiatives for what was called “the day after the end of the war.”
Two senior Arab diplomats said that the conference will be held on Thursday and will involve the foreign ministers of only five countries in the Middle East that played a major role in facilitating talks between Israel and the Palestinians.
According to the “Times of Israel,” the unannounced meeting will also be attended by a representative of the Palestinian Authority as part of what the sources described as Riyadh’s ongoing effort to expand its cooperation with Ramallah, especially in light of the Kingdom’s increasing interest in strengthening its regional and global standing through the normalization talks with Israel that it is leading. The newspaper indicated that Egypt, Jordan, the Emirates, and Qatar are the four participating countries, indicating that out of the six members of the Gulf Cooperation Council, 3 countries will be absent: Bahrain, Kuwait, and Oman.
She explained that the summit’s agenda will be topped by increasing pressure to cease fire in Gaza by using the influence of countries participating in the reconstruction efforts, in addition to possible regional integration that may include Israel according to the efforts led by Washington.
The two diplomats confirmed to the newspaper that steps toward “an irreversible path to an eventual Palestinian state” were one of the conditions that Israel had to implement so that the participating countries could promote regional integration and Gaza reconstruction efforts.
The Israeli newspaper reported that there were previous secret meetings organized by Riyadh with Cairo, Amman and Ramallah about the possibility of regional powers sending forces to help secure Gaza.
According to the newspaper, the meeting will focus more on reforming the Palestinian Authority and taking advantage of Qatar’s influence over Hamas, which will be able to survive in some way but will not be part of the government.
